Box Score GREENWOOD – Cierra Kendrick posted a double-double, leading the first-place Lander Lady Bearcats to an 85-60 victory over Peach Belt Conference rival Francis Marion 85-60 Wednesday night in the annual "Think Pink" game at Horne Arena.
Lander improved to 18-4 overall and 11-2 in the Peach Belt.
The Patriots fell to 6-16, 3-10.
The purpose of the "Think Pink" game held in conjunction with the American Cancer Society is to help bring awareness to breast cancer. There was free admission for all who wore pink and arrived before halftime.
Kendrick led the Lady Bearcats with 13 points and 10 rebounds, while Breshay Johnson also scored 13 points.
Aarika Judge added 11 points for Lander, Ty'hesha Reynolds scored 10 points, and Bre Crum led the team with six assists. Portia McCray added nine points and eight rebounds, Briana Gipson scored nine points, and Ashleigh Zandi also scored nine points while adding four assists.
Camille Dash led Francis Marion with 13 points, Cy'Erra Mills added 12 points and a game-high eight assists, Khayani Chandler scored 10 points, and Alaysia Watts had a game-high 14 rebounds. Mills led the Patriots with eight assists while Dash added six assists.
Lander made 30 of 70 shots from the floor (43 percent), 18 of 28 free throws (64 percent) and seven of 21 from 3-point range (33 percent).
The Patriots made 24 of 72 shots from the floor (33 percent), six of 15 free throws (40 percent) and six of 21 from behind the arc (29 percent).
Each team had 50 rebounds.
Watts hit a 3 to give Francis Marion a 9-5 lead at the 15-minute mark. But Lander went on a 16-2 run to build its first double-digit advantage of the game at 21-11 with 10:39 to go. Johnson tallied six points during the run, Gipson scored twice, Judge made a 3, and Mylea McKenith converted a three-point play.
The lead stayed double digits the rest of the half including a pair of 14-point advantages, 31-17 with 4:13 left on Johnson's basket and 41-27 at the half after Judge nailed a 3 with five seconds to go.
Judge's 3 and McKenith's steal and layup increased Lander's lead to 46-29 in the first minute of the second half.
Crum's put-back matched the 17-point lead at 51-34 with 16:34 left. But the Lady Bearcats went scoreless over the next four minutes and Francis Marion closed within 51-38 on baskets by Chandler and Dash.
Kendrick and McCray each scored inside, restoring Lander's 17-point advantage at 55-38 with 11:30 left.
Watts scored to pull the Patriots within 55-40 just inside the 11-minute mark. But the Lady Bearcats scored the game's next 10 points, building their lead to 65-40 with 7:51 to go. Kayla West rebounded a Reynolds missed 3 and laid it in, Reynolds made two free throws, Kendrick hit one of two free throws and added a basket, and Zandi completed the run with a 3.
Dash and Emily Green scored from behind the arc to cut Francis Marion's deficit to 67-48 with 5:17 to go.
Reynolds scored on a fast-break bucket for a 72-52 lead with 3:25 left. McCray scored on consecutive possessions inside, converting a three-point play after the second basket, as Lander matched its largest lead at 82-57 with one minute to go.
The lead grew to 26 on a Reynolds 3 with 37 seconds left.
